C.E. Johnson writes protective hero romance with a side of suspense!
She wrote her first book in 2017 and hasn't stopped writing since. C.E. is best known for her romantic suspense series, The Elements of the Heart, which features protective heroes, strong heroines in danger, small town feels, and love that will have your heart swelling.
She's a dog lover, iced coffee enthusiast, and dreams of living in a cabin deep in the woods one day like so many of her characters do.
C.E. Johnson currently lives in the Midwest with her husband, two kids, and a bunch of spoiled rotten animals.

Watch Me Breathe is the story of Lucas “Whack” Redman, owner of roofing company and former convict and Montana “Tana” Hutchinson, widow, single mother of two-year-old, Iris and waitress at a local diner. Tana and Lucas meet when Tana’s car runs off the road across the street from the jobsite when Lucas and his crew are replacing a roof. Lucas holds Tana’s hand until the ambulance arrives, his employee, Mason removes Iris from her car seat and keeps her safe in Lucas’s truck. While in Lucas’s truck, Iris discovers a dog stuffed animal. Tana and Lucas run into each other again at the diner where Tana works and she spills of tray of drinks on him. Watch Me Breathe was a pleasant introduction to C.E. Johnson. I found the writing good, the story both romantic and suspenseful and the characters well-defined.
Montana is sympathetic. She's a hard-working, widow with a child. Her mother is the best of mama bears and the daughter is a sweet child. The three are doing OK living next door to each other. Lucas is an ex-con with a sad past that follows him today. He's lost so much but he's a great guy. His criminal conviction was legally just but morally maybe not so much. He rushes to Tana and Iris's aid after Tana crashes her car and takes care of them until the ambulance can reach them. He even gives Iris a stuffed dog that has a lot of history from his past. Iris is immediately totally attached to the toy and Tana's heart starts to melt for the tough but sexy guy. When he runs into Tana at the diner she works at, he again feels a draw that started back at the crash. When he defends her from her creepy and vindictive boss she's even more drawn to him. Soon they're seeing a lot of each other.
The story is sweet. Lucas is great with Tana and Iris. Their pasts, her boss and a criminally inclined employee and the typical relationship misunderstandings cause lots of grief giving the story the kind of suspense I like with my romance. I recommend this book.
